Discover Your Destiny (With The Monk Who Sold His Ferrari) – Robin Sharma
If you’re experiencing one of those life crisis moments this concise tome takes you on a journey through the 7 stages of re-awakening. Told as a modern-day fable the story focuses on the high-powered life of a successful yet unhappy executive who finds his life crumbling around him. A chance encounter with the Monk, of the title, redirects his course to a 6-month adventure that will open his eyes to truth and authenticity.
The engaging tone of the story will inspire you to reassess your own journey and to appreciate your experiences more fully. You’ll also feel inclined to pass this book on so that someone else has an opportunity to benefit from a serendipitous moment.
